This fixes linking issues if you happen to have a symlink as part of your build path.
Previously, mayaUsd_add_rpath would use "realpaths" when comparing to origin, but mayaUsd_init_rpath would ONLY use a realpath if the argument was originally a relative path. Thus, if you fed in an absolute path with a symlink, you would end up comparing a symlink path to a realpath.
